Signs You Have This Problem

Camera faults are very diagnosable from the symptom, which keeps the repair targeted and cheap.

Everything is blurry or will not focus

Often a broken optical image stabilisation module or a lens knocked out of alignment by a drop.

Black screen when the camera opens

Usually a disconnected or failed camera module rather than a software problem, though we check both.

A rattling sound when you shake the phone

That is the OIS magnets loose inside a damaged module. It is a definite hardware failure and the sound confirms it.

Cracked rear lens glass

The small glass covering the camera is a separate part from the back panel on most phones, and is often cheap to replace on its own.

What Causes It

Rear cameras sit under a small raised glass cover that takes the impact whenever the phone lands face-up, so cracked lens glass is extremely common and often the only damage. Inside the module, optical image stabilisation uses tiny suspended magnets that a hard drop can dislodge, which is the rattle people describe. Front cameras fail less from impact and more from liquid ingress, since they sit near the earpiece slot. Dust behind the lens after a poor previous repair also shows up as persistent blurry patches in the same place on every photo.

How We Fix It

Camera repairs start from £25 for the lens glass and rise for full module replacement.

We check first whether the problem is the outer lens glass or the module itself, because the difference in cost is significant and plenty of phones only need the glass. Where the module has failed we replace it and confirm focus, stabilisation, flash, portrait and video modes across all lenses before returning the phone. On models where the camera is paired to the board we will explain up front what that means for your handset. Front and rear camera prices are listed per model on our iPhone and Samsung pages.

Phone Camera Repair FAQs

Just the small glass over my camera is cracked. Is that a cheap fix?
Usually yes, and it is worth doing promptly. Once that glass is broken, dust gets onto the lens and you end up needing the whole module instead.
My camera works but every photo has a blurry patch in the same spot.
That is debris or moisture behind the lens. Cleaning or module replacement clears it completely.
Is a rattling camera worth repairing?
Yes. The rattle means the stabilisation module is damaged, and left alone it will keep degrading photo quality. It is a contained repair.
